Lisbon

Lisbon is the capital city of Portugal and is known for its rich history, diverse culture, and picturesque landscapes. It is situated on the western coast of the Iberian Peninsula, along the Atlantic Ocean. Lisbon is characterized by its hilly terrain, stunning viewpoints, and iconic architecture, including historic landmarks such as the Belém Tower, Jerónimos Monastery, and São Jorge Castle. The city is also famous for its vibrant neighborhoods, such as Alfama and Bairro Alto, which feature narrow streets, colorful buildings, and a lively nightlife. Lisbon’s cultural scene is marked by traditional Fado music, museums, art galleries, and a thriving culinary landscape. As a significant economic and political center, Lisbon plays a vital role in shaping the identity of Portugal and its influence within Europe.
